Santa Barbara Zoo
The Santa Barbara Zoo is located on 30 acres near the ocean in Santa Barbara, CA. It was built on the site of what was known as the Child Estate. The zoo has been ranked numerous times as one of the nation's best small zoos. Foundation Relations Officer and Grant Writer
Exciting opportunity for an experienced individual to join our Advancement department. We may have the dream job for you right here in beautiful Santa Barbara. Do what you love while contributing to our mission!
Position Summary:
Under the general direction of the Director of Advancement, the Foundation Relations Officer is responsible for securing grant funding from foundation, corporate, service organization and government resources in support of the Zoo's overall mission. They will regularly interact with donors, guests, and community members, providing a high level of customer service while promoting the Zoo's mission.
Position Essential Duties:
Grants Management
Regularly reports fundraising activities and progress to the Director of Advancement
Actively researches and seeks grant opportunities from various sources that match the goals and objectives of the Zoo
Develops and maintains effective, fruitful, and long-term working relationships with grantors
Prior to submitting proposals, communicates with potential grantors regarding their goals and objectives to ensure they are in line with the goals and objectives of the Zoo
Gathers statistical and other information from various departments using timely and effective communication to ensure grant and reporting deadlines are met
Writes and submits grant proposals on time to foundation, corporate, service organization, and government funding sources
Follows up with grantors to determine/monitor grant status in timely manner
Writes and submits thank you letters and other correspondence with grantors and potential grantors
Engages the board in the grants program with monthly reports and by inviting key members to represent the Zoo during foundation visits
Maintains a grants program calendar to track grant and reporting deadlines as well as to track communication, cultivation, and stewardship efforts. Reviews deadlines annually to ensure calendar is up-to-date.
Ensures continuity in relationship management by maintaining files to track contacts, communications, submission and reporting deadlines, and philanthropic commitments in shared Advancement donor database and donor files. This includes maintaining organized grant files including a copy of all submissions (including online).
Accurately tracks and records donor relationship management activities related to grants
Develops and evaluates measures of success in grant activities and produces reports to track results
